1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Convert 3.5 gallons into cups. (1 gal = 16 cups)
Back
56 cups
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Write 7 in scientific notation.
Back
7 x 10^0
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How would you write 0.0005 in scientific notation?
Back
5 x 10^-4
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does 'deci' equal?
Back
tenth
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Write the answer in scientific notation: 5 x 10^8 - 3.4 x 10^8 = ?
Back
1.6 x 10^8
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the purpose of dimensional analysis?
Back
To convert units from one system to another and ensure equations are dimensionally consistent.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Define scientific notation.
Back
A method of expressing numbers as a product of a coefficient and a power of 10.
